Device for controlling rotational speed of electric motor

1. A device for controlling the speed of an electric motor, comprising a chopper connected between a power source and an electric motor;
- an accelerator;
means for detecting the current through said motor;
a controller for controlling the duty ratio of said chopper in accordance with the degree of actuation of said accelerator and said current through said motor and for controlling said current through said motor within a restricted range;
a bypass contacor for connecting said motor directly with said power source by short-circuiting said chopper; and
a bypass contactor control means for opening and closing said bypass contactor so that the contactor will be open whenever the duty ratio of the chopper is below a predetermined maximum value, wherein said bypass contactor control means includes therein a first means for detecting full actuation of said accelerator and a second means for continuously monitoring the duty cycle of the chopper for detecting every time the duty ratio of said chopper equals or exceeds a predetermined maximum value continuously throughout the operation of the motor by detecting every time when the value of the motor current reaches a predetermined value corresponding to the predetermined duty ratio so that said bypass contactor will be closed when said accelerator is actuated to the full extent and when said duty ratio approximately equals said predetermined maximum value, and said bypass contactor will be open whenever said duty ratio of the chopper is below the predetermined maximum value.

Abstract
A device for controlling the rotational speed of an electric motor, provided with a bypass contactor for short-circuiting a chopper, wherein the bypass contactor is turned on when the accelerator is actuated to the full extent and when the duty ratio of the chopper exceeds a predetermined value, so that the shock due to the turn-on of the bypass contactor is eliminated.
